To start off an introduction in a PEEL paragraph about California, you might begin with a broad statement that captures the state's significance, such as its diverse landscapes, cultural richness, or economic impact. For example, "California, known as the Golden State, boasts a unique blend of natural beauty and cultural diversity that makes it a pivotal part of the United States." This sets the stage for your topic sentence and allows you to narrow down your focus in the rest of the paragraph.

To easily peel a clementine, start by cutting off the top and bottom of the fruit. Then make a shallow cut along one side and gently peel the skin off in sections. This should help you remove the peel without much effort.

You can peel potatoes up to 24 hours in advance before they start to lose their freshness and quality. It's best to store them in water to prevent browning.
Post-it Notes were introduced first, in 1980, by 3M. They were developed by Spencer Silver, who created a repositionable adhesive. Press and Peel, which is a form of transfer paper, came later and is typically used for crafting and printing applications. Thus, Post-it Notes precede Press and Peel in terms of market introduction.
